Modelsim入门:利用方法进行后仿真的工程实践
需积分: 0 135 浏览量
更新于2024-08-14
收藏 641KB PPT 举报
Modelsim是一款由Model公司开发的专业HDL(硬件描述语言)仿真器,广泛应用于VHDL和Verilog的设计验证。作为业界通用的仿真器之一,它提供了比Quartus自带仿真器更为强大的功能,如逐步执行、实时变量查看和连续数据流分析。Modelsim有三种主要版本:SE(标准版)、PE(专业版)和OEM,其中嵌入在FPGA制造商工具中的通常是OEM版本,如ModelSim-Altera和ModelSim-Xilinx。
对于初学者,入门学习Modelsim的关键在于熟悉工具的基本操作。首先,通过Modelsim自带的教程开始,这个教程可以从Help菜单下的SEPDFDocumentation>Tutorial找到,它详细介绍了从基础设置到高级功能的使用方法,对新手非常友好。在创建项目时,例如"count4"工程,需添加相关源文件如count4.vo和count_tp.v,以及必要的库文件cycloneii_atoms.v,尽管不直接使用源代码,但理解这些文件的作用至关重要。
Modelsim的安装过程需要合法的许可证,通常通过Kengen生成license.dat文件。安装时选择Full product安装,确保安装所有功能。安装过程中可能会遇到硬件安全性的检查,按照提示进行即可。
此外,Modelsim的强大功能体现在其支持多种平台,包括PC、UNIX和Linux,这使得它能够在各种环境下进行高效仿真。学习的重点在于掌握如何建立项目、设置仿真环境、编写和使用Testbench、理解和解读仿真结果,以及如何优化波形文件的创建以减少手动输入的繁琐工作。
在实际应用中,Modelsim的仿真功能可以帮助设计者检测电路的正确性,特别是在处理复杂的系统行为和测试设计的边界条件时。掌握Modelsim不仅有利于提高设计效率,还能提升设计质量,是现代电子设计不可或缺的工具。
2010-08-17 上传
130 浏览量
2022-03-12 上传
2022-11-15 上传
2011-07-17 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
辰可爱啊
- 粉丝: 17
- 资源: 2万+
最新资源
- 高清艺术文字图标资源,PNG和ICO格式免费下载
- mui框架HTML5应用界面组件使用示例教程
- Vue.js开发利器:chrome-vue-devtools插件解析
- 掌握ElectronBrowserJS:打造跨平台电子应用
- 前端导师教程:构建与部署社交证明页面
- Java多线程与线程安全在断点续传中的实现
- 免Root一键卸载安卓预装应用教程
- 易语言实现高级表格滚动条完美控制技巧
- 超声波测距尺的源码实现
- 数据可视化与交互:构建易用的数据界面
- 实现Discourse外聘回复自动标记的简易插件
- 链表的头插法与尾插法实现及长度计算
- Playwright与Typescript及Mocha集成:自动化UI测试实践指南
- 128x128像素线性工具图标下载集合
- 易语言安装包程序增强版:智能导入与重复库过滤
- 利用AJAX与Spotify API在Google地图中探索世界音乐排行榜